What Is an IQ Test?

An IQ test, or Intelligence Quotient test, is a standardized assessment designed to measure specific cognitive abilities. These typically include logical reasoning, mathematical skills, verbal comprehension, memory, and spatial awareness. Most modern IQ tests are structured so that the average score is 100, with most people falling within a certain range above or below that number.

IQ tests are not random quizzes. They are carefully designed, tested, and statistically validated to ensure consistency and reliability. When administered correctly, an IQ test can provide useful insights into how a person processes information and solves structured problems.

A Brief History of IQ Testing

The origins of the IQ test date back to the early 1900s, when French psychologist Alfred Binet developed the first intelligence assessment. His goal was not to label intelligence permanently, but to identify students who needed additional educational support. Over time, IQ testing evolved and spread worldwide, becoming a standard tool in education, psychology, and even employment screening.

As the use of IQ tests expanded, so did debates about their fairness, accuracy, and limitations. These discussions continue today, especially as our understanding of intelligence grows more complex.

What an IQ Test Measures—and What It Doesn’t

An IQ test is effective at measuring certain types of intelligence, particularly analytical and logical thinking. It can show how well someone recognizes patterns, understands relationships between concepts, and applies reasoning to solve problems.

However, an IQ test does not measure everything. Creativity, emotional intelligence, leadership ability, motivation, and practical life skills are largely outside its scope. Someone may score moderately on an IQ test but still be an exceptional entrepreneur, artist, or communicator. Intelligence is multi-dimensional, and no single test can capture it fully.

Are IQ Tests Still Relevant Today?

Despite their limitations, IQ tests remain useful when applied thoughtfully. In clinical psychology, they can help diagnose learning disabilities or cognitive impairments. In education, they can assist in identifying gifted students who may need advanced instruction.

However, most experts agree that an IQ test should never be used in isolation. A more complete picture of intelligence includes creativity, emotional awareness, social skills, and learning habits—especially in fast-changing environments where fastlearners thrive.
